HuffPost is the leading source of news and commentary for the most diverse and connected generation ever.

• Stay informed with breaking news alerts and top story digests.
• Browse Pulitzer-prize winning articles and interactive content.
• Enjoy all 16 international Huffington Post editions in one app.
• Scan our library of immersive 360 videos, virtual reality and augmented reality.
• Save stories for offline reading.

Tracking gone mad

Just updated the app and got the usual permissions agreement bit. Found the “options” part hidden behind the top banner and went in to turn off tracking, expecting it to be nice and simple. Wrong. Lots of different parts you need to go through to reject all the tracking, including one part with a couple of hundred companies who would get your data if you don’t go through the list and manually deselect every single one. This is the kind of sneaky stealth that has no purpose other than to turn your data into a little pile of cash.

App now deleted and will not use again. Avoid if don’t want to be monetised for someone else’s benefit.
